Carl Moritz Weber
Summary
Carl Moritz Weber is a human[1]. He was born in Coburg[2]. He was born on 1801[3]. He died in Pfarrkirchen[4]. He died on April 12, 1881[5]. He worked as a conductor[6] and composer[7].
